Scraped HTML Content Extraction

To effectively extract the title and body text from scraped HTML content, one should follow a systematic approach. This process generally involves the use of various programming libraries or tools designed for web scraping and parsing HTML data.

In Python, for instance, libraries like Beautiful Soup or lxml can be utilized to parse HTML. Here is a basic outline of the procedure:

  1. Fetch the HTML: Use a library like requests to retrieve the HTML content from a given URL.
  2. Parse the HTML: Implement Beautiful Soup to parse the HTML content and create a searchable object.
  3. Extract Title: Navigate to the <title> tag and extract its content.
  4. Extract Body: Identify the <body> section or the relevant tags that contain the main content and extract that.

It’s important to ensure that the extracted data is clean and relevant, which may require additional processing like removing unwanted tags or handling character encodings.
